5.3

Relay functions

5.3.1

General information

The analyzer has 12 relays that are independent of each other and can 
be linked to the analyzer module. The following functions are possible 
for a relay output:

Proportional controller (Frequency controller or Pulse-width control-
ler, see section 5.3.2)

Limit indicator (see section 5.3.3)

Indicator contact for a monitored event (see section 5.3.8)

5.3.2

Proportional controller: Basic information

In the case of proportional control, a relay switches cyclically on and off 
in a defined measured value range (proportional range). At the same 
time, the relay switches with a: 

duration of operation that corresponds to the measured value 
(pulse-width controller, see page 5-30) or

switching frequency (frequency controller, see page 5-32).

Proportional controllers can be used in the following way:

Regulation with a single relay:
a regulating range with 

Start value

 and 

End value

 is defined. No 

regulation takes place above and below the range of regulation (see 
page 5-30).

Regulation with two relays:
a regulating range with 

Start value

 and 

End value

 is defined for each 

relay. One relay regulates in the upper range of regulation and a 
further relay in the lower range of regulation (see page 5-30).
